2x-3y=8 . How do I solve this ?

If we're solving for x:
First we have to add 3y to both sides.
2x - 3y + 3y = 8 + 3y
2x = 3y + 8
Last, we divide both sides by 2.
2x/2 = 3y+8/2
Answer: x = 3/2y + 4

If we're solving for y:
First, we have to add -2x to both sides.
2x - 3y + -2x = 8 + -2x
Last, we divide both sides by -3.
-3y/-3 = -2x + 8/-3
Answer: y = 2/3x + -8/3

Convert 4.2% to an<br> equivalent decimal.
hjlf

Answer:

4.2% = 0.042

Step-by-step explanation:

You need to divide the percentage by 100 to get its equivalent decimal:

100% = 1 because

100 ÷ 100 = 1

Therefore,

4.2% = 0.042 because

4.2 ÷ 100 = 0.042
